Our client is looking for a full time Gallery Registrar to join their team at their brand-new gallery opening in LA.
This individual will need to show self -determination, initiative and possess strong people skills. A passion for the art world is also important as this position will include exhibition installation, production and shipping.
Responsibilities:
- Manging inventory and producing condition reports which relate to the receipt, storage and preservation of works.
- Coordinating shipments and installations for sale, fairs, and exhibitions. This will include safe handling, packing and documentation of work.
- Negotiating with a number of different shipping companies to ensure the most cost-effective and accurate shipments and estimates.
- Participating in gallery installations, fairs and openings including any external events which may take place outside of normal hours and include travel.
- Overseeing the framing and stretching of artworks that are being shipped.
- Manging the staffing needs for the gallery including budgeting, quotations and keeping up to date records for service providers.
- Assisting with the photography of gallery exhibitions and works as and where needed.
- Working closely alongside the gallery director to deal with sales requests and organising specific collector viewings.
- Handling any incoming mail enquiries which include deliveries.
- Ensuring that the gallery space remains presentable and liaising with the landlord to oversee any repairs that may be required.
